Green and Leslie Hit the Rail

Level 17 : 2,000/5,000, 5,000 ante

Adam Todd opened to 12,000 in early position and Brian Green shipped all in for 89,000 in the cutoff. The action was back on Todd and the two players had a discussion about the previous hand before Todd made the call.

Green confidently flipped over {a-Spades}{q-Clubs} but was flipping against the {8-Clubs}{8-Diamonds} of Todd. The board ran out {9-Diamonds}{4-Spades}{2-Hearts}{6-Hearts}{j-Diamonds} and Green was unable to find any help as he was forced to settle for a min-cash.

In the next hand, Todd opened to 12,000 again from under the gun and Jacob Corda ripped all in for around 120,000 on his left. Tim Leslie also pushed all in for 48,000 in the big blind and Todd eventually folded.

Corda turned over {a-Hearts}{a-Diamonds} which had Leslie's {j-Spades}{j-Diamonds} in big trouble. The board of {k-Spades}{k-Diamonds}{3-Spades}{7-Clubs}{4-Clubs} secured the win for Corda and Leslie was the next player to hit the rail.

Higgins Doubles Through Pho

Level 18 : 3,000/6,000, 6,000 ante

Matthew Higgins was down to just ten big blinds and shoved all in for 60,000 in early position. Chico Pho called on the button and the blinds both folded.

Matthew Higgins: {a-Hearts}{q-Hearts}
Chico Pho: {j-Hearts}{j-Diamonds}

It was a coin flip and Higgins took the lead on the {a-Spades}{10-Hearts}{5-Spades} flop. The {9-Clubs} on the turn nor the {8-Diamonds} on the river would help Pho as he sent over a small double up.

Whittington Gets Paid Off

Level 18 : 3,000/6,000, 6,000 ante

Joshua Johnson opened to 14,000 in early position and was called by Blake Whittington on his left along with Johnny Landreth in the big blind. The flop fell {q-Spades}{6-Clubs}{6-Diamonds} and Landreth checked to Johnson who continued for 29,000. Whittington called and Landreth got out of the way.

The turn brought the {4-Spades} and both players checked to the {a-Clubs} on the river. Johnson led out with a bet of 45,000 and Whittington raised to 128,000. It didn't take long for Johnson to call and Whittington showed {a-Hearts}{k-Clubs} which was enough to beat the {a-Spades}{8-Spades} of Johnson.

Sheaves Flushes Small to the Rail

Level 18 : 3,000/6,000, 6,000 ante

Sean Small raised it up to 13,000 from under the gun and picked up four callers along the way. The flop fell {k-Clubs}{q-Spades}{8-Clubs} and Small continued with a bet of 34,000. Warren Sheaves was the only player to make the call from a couple of seats over.

The turn brought the {a-Clubs} and Small went into the tank for over two minutes before moving all in for his last 68,000 chips. Sheaves instantly called and tabled {j-Clubs}{9-Clubs} for a turned flush. Small was still drawing live with {8-Spades}{8-Diamonds} but the {10-Spades} on the river did not pair the board and Small was eliminated.
